The answer to 'my drain smells bad' is that a foul odor coming from your drain is usually caused by a buildup of organic matter, mold, or bacteria. Common symptoms include a persistent unpleasant smell, slow draining, and even visible gunk or debris in the drain. The good news is there are several DIY solutions you can try before calling a professional plumber.
First, try using a drain cleaner or baking soda and vinegar to break down the blockage and flush out the odor-causing material. If that doesn't work, you may need to use a plunger or auger to physically dislodge the clog. However, if the smell persists or the drain is severely clogged, it's best to call in a professional plumber who can properly diagnose and fix the issue.
